Her Wikipedia page has also been updated. Included under the title The Debut and Carousel of Time it reads:
"In 2020 Evancho began recording an album of covers of Joni Mitchell songs, produced by Fred Mollin, at Sound Stage Studio in Nashville. She released the disc, titled Carousel of Time, on September 9, 2022. Before its release, Evancho introduced four singles from the album: "River" in October 2020, "Both Sides Now" in May 2022, "A Case of You" in July, and "Blue", in August 2022, which she performed on Good Day New York in September. O'Rourke, reviewing the album for TalentRecap.com, wrote: "Evancho brings a signature ethereal quality to Mitchell’s music, as well as a clear emotional connection with the lyrics.
Evancho has been giving concerts featuring the songs on Carousel of Time, together with some of Evancho's other favorites, starting at 54 Below in New York City in September and continuing in October at City Winery venues in Nashville, Boston, Washington, D.C, Philadelphia, Chicago and Atlanta. Marilyn Lester wrote of her concert at 54 Below in Theater Pizzazz: "Her tone is as clear as a bell, as smooth as glass, and her range spectacular. ... However, while Evancho identifies with Joni Mitchell's artistry, her mic, with much too much reverb, did the music no favors. She often wasn’t able to be clear in her enunciation. ... Evancho in her enthusiasm is unfocused, and one wonders if, at times, she really understands the lyric she’s singing. The purity and perfection of her voice deserves to be carefully managed, as does the person behind that miraculous artistry."
Also, included under 2016 to present:
"Evancho has stated that her career was interrupted in 2019 by a mental breakdown related to the eating disorder and body dysmorphia that she has struggled with since 2015; she also stated that during the COVID-19 pandemic she was in a car accident in which she fractured her back, and her parents divorced. In 2020, she competed on season 3 of The Masked Singer as "Kitty", finishing in fifth place. Evancho performed a concert titled "Home for the Holidays" in December 2021 at Millersville University in Millersville, Pennsylvania."
Carousel of Time is also included in her discography:
2022 Carousel of Time Independent studio album
Note: The date of her "mental breakdown" and car accident (2019) is incorrect, taken from her Instagram announcement. It should read late 2020, and also, her parents were divorced in 2020/2021.... Jackie was on tour in 2019 until she performed on The Masked Singer in 2020. Concerts followed on Feb. 27th, 28th and 29th of 2020.
